    What is Dr. Deborah Johnson's specialty?

    Dr. Johnson is a Anatomic Pathologist & Clinical Pathologist near Jonesboro, AR. A pathologist focuses on the causes and nature of diseases, contributing to diagnosis, prognosis, and treatment by applying knowledge from biological, chemical, and physical sciences in the laboratory. They utilize microscopic examinations of tissue specimens, cells, and body fluids, along with clinical laboratory tests on fluids and secretions, to diagnose, exclude, or monitor diseases.
